There are properties you pass by, and then there are properties that are rooted in history. Set on approximately 3.5 acres, only 10 minutes south of Peterborough, this brick farmhouse has quietly witnessed generations come and go. For 50 years, one family has shaped this land, making maple syrup in the spring and apple cider in the fall, cross-country skiing in the winter, farming vegetables through the summer. As you approach the house down the maple-lined driveway, you begin to understand what makes this property special. The land remains rich and fertile, currently supporting one acre of organic vegetable farming, with space to grow. The beautiful home offers 5 bedrooms, 2 full bathrooms, 2 kitchens, and multiple living areas. The layout supports duplex functionality and has been used this way in the past, offering flexibility for multi-generational living or income potential. Inside, the century character has been thoughtfully preserved, with original trim details, wood floors, and a warmth that only a home of this era can offer. The home has been carefully maintained and updated, with many improvements including electrical, insulation, a metal roof, and more. Light moves through the home in a way that shapes the day. The covered and screened-in porches create a naturally shaded space overlooking the lawn. To the north, a creek and marsh border the property, bringing birdsong and gentle breezes. The outbuildings further extend what is possible here. A barn that has hosted gatherings. A large drive shed with space for three vehicles. Additional outbuildings provide practical storage. There is also an income-producing microfit solar installed, with 6 years remaining on the contract. Finding an acreage of this quality within 10 minutes of Peterborough is increasingly rare.
